The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ra, released in early 2025, and the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2023), launched in mid-2023, are both smartphones that offer integrated stylus functionality. While the Galaxy S25 Ultra represents a premium flagship experience with advanced features and a robust software commitment, the Moto G Stylus 5G (2023) provides a more accessible option, focusing on core functionality and a smooth user experience for its segment. Both devices run on the Android operating system, though they differ significantly in their software support timelines and overall hardware capabilities.

Choosing between the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ra and the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2023) depends heavily on individual priorities and usage patterns. User feedback for the Galaxy S25 Ultra often praises its exceptional camera system, vibrant display, powerful performance, and long-term software support. Common praise for the Moto G Stylus 5G (2023) highlights its strong battery life, smooth 120Hz display, and the practical inclusion of a stylus at a more accessible point.
Conversely, some users of the Moto G Stylus 5G (2023) have noted concerns regarding its camera performance in challenging light, the presence of pre-installed applications, and a less extensive software update policy compared to premium devices. For the Galaxy S25 Ultra, while generally well-received, the removal of Bluetooth functionality from the S Pen was a point of discussion for some users who relied on those specific features.
Users prioritizing a top-tier camera experience, cutting-edge performance for demanding applications, a highly durable build, and an extended period of software updates will find the Galaxy S25 Ultra well-suited to their needs. Its expansive, bright display and advanced S Pen features cater to those seeking a premium, feature-rich device for productivity and entertainment.
On the other hand, users who value a long-lasting battery, a smooth display for everyday interactions, and the convenience of an integrated stylus for basic note-taking and navigation, all within a more modest hardware package, may lean towards the Moto G Stylus 5G (2023). It serves as a practical choice for those who need a reliable smartphone with stylus functionality without the extensive features of a flagship.
